Judging Criteria:

Pitches are judged on a scale of 1-10 by the following measure.

  • Problem Statement: Clearly express a specific problem they want to solve.
  • Customer Solution: Clearly express a specific solution to the problem they want to solve.
  • Presentation: Deliver an engaging, informative, and persuasive pitch within 2 minutes.
